Caleb Jumps into Healthcare

When you were little, what did you want to be when you grew up? For Caleb, his dream was to become a nurse, and now he is on his way to making that dream a reality. 

Caleb Peponis is a freshman here at Heritage High School with a passion for helping others. Caleb has taken a step toward his goal by becoming a member of HOSA (Health Occupations Students of America). Caleb is very active in the club by participating in putting up American flags around the community for Labor Day, going to Spooky Movie Night, and the Ice skating event held in December. ¨We’ve learned life skills that we can use in the healthcare field just like leadership, like team building stuff,” Caleb explained about the activities he’s involved in with HOSA.

Alongside HOSA, Caleb has also taken the Essentials to Healthcare class (The first class of the Healthcare pathway) with Mrs. Johnson, and has plans on continuing with the pathway. Caleb says, “So, when I was really little I wanted to be like a pediatrician. And then I was like, I thought about it. Like, that’s a lot of school years, and I don’t really want to do that. So at this point, I still want to do something with kids, but I want to do more of the nursing aspect of it.”

Caleb is not only very involved in the healthcare opportunities at Heritage but, Caleb also is an all honors student having taken classes including ELA honors with Mrs. McCole, Government Honors with Mrs. Attwell, and is currently taking Physical Science Honors. Caleb considered taking AP Government, but decided it would be best to wait to take any APs. He hopes to take AP classes in either his Junior or Senior years. Another interest of Caleb’s is Graphic Design, especially after he took the first Graphic Design class. It’s one of his other goals to finish the Graphics Design pathway, as well as to also continue taking Journalism as one of his electives.

So far, Caleb has loved his time at Heritage and says he feels the opportunities the experienced so far in the short amount of time he’s been here has already prepared him for his future whatever it may be.
